Fiesta Inn Merida
21.032406, -89.628601The 4-star Fiesta Inn Merida boasts a fitness centre, various recreational opportunities, and a golf course as well as a setting just steps from the shopping district of Merida. Nestled in an entertainment area, this eco-friendly inn is situated 0.6 km from Gran Plaza, which is good for shopping lovers.
Location
The smoke-free accommodation is located within a 100-metre distance of Juega y Juega, and 6 km from Paseo Montejo. Mayapan Mayan Ruins is not too far from the Fiesta Inn Merida, and Manuel Crescencio Rejon International airport is 15 km away. Also, this Merida property lies just steps from convention centres. You can easily find Palacio de Gobierno del Estado de Yucatan 7 km from Fiesta Inn Merida.
Situated in the heart of Merida, the accommodation is a short way from Mayan World Museum bus stop.
Rooms
The rooms have private bathrooms with a separate toilet and a shower. Guests can make use of a coffee maker, and relax with wireless internet and a cable TV. Enjoy views of the city, while staying at this Merida hotel.
Eat & Drink
Breakfast is provided in the restaurant. The bar serves domestic drinks. Choose from an unlimited choice of international dishes at La Isla which is in front of the hotel.
Leisure & Business
At the property you may pay for a summer terrace and an outdoor pool area. An outdoor pool is on-site at the Fiesta Inn. At the accommodation, guests can take part in fitness classes offered at a gym. The property, located 550 metres from Mayan World Museum of Merida, comes with meeting rooms and a business centre featuring banquet and meeting facilities, and a photocopier.
